As reported on Wednesday (July 24), the Federal Trade Commission (FTC) has said it will fine Facebook $5 billion in the wake of the company’s mishandling of millions of users’ personal data. The FTC also has mandated stricter oversight over third-party apps.

Among the tenets of the settlement, the company must establish a board committee that is focused on privacy, and as reported by news outlets including CNBC , CEO Mark Zuckerberg will report certified statements to the FTC, on a quarterly basis, on how the firm is protecting user data and privacy.

Shares in Facebook were down 8 percent after a Wall Street Journal story revealed the Federal Trade Commission (FTC) will have jurisdiction to examine the social media company over competition concerns. Facebook lost $33 billion out of its market cap and settled at $472 billion.
